Function gluon_parser::parse_partial_expr
source · pub fn parse_partial_expr<'ast, Id, S>(
arena: ArenaRef<'_, 'ast, Id>,
symbols: &mut dyn IdentEnv<Ident = Id>,
type_cache: &TypeCache<Id, ArcType<Id>>,
input: &S
) -> Result<SpannedExpr<'ast, Id>, (Option<SpannedExpr<'ast, Id>>, ParseErrors)>where
Id: Clone + AsRef<str> + Debug,
S: ?Sized + ParserSource,